Google has officially named the next version of Android, which is due to be released this fall: Android 10. Breaking the 10-year history of naming releases after desserts, the company is bailing on providing a codename beginning with a subsequent letter of the alphabet , which is the way we’ve been referring to Android up to now. This year is Android 10, next year will be Android 11, and so on.

Android is a global brand, used by more people in India and Brazil than in the US, so going with an English word for the dessert leaves some regions out. Pie isn’t always a dessert, “lollipop” can be hard to pronounce in some regions, and “marshmallows aren’t really a thing in a lot of places,” Samat says. Numbers, at least, are universal. Google will still make the traditional Android statue of the robot, but it’ll be of the number 10 instead of a dessert.
